Senior executives from leading Gas & Tankers shipping companies
will participate in panels and presentations at the 19th Annual
Capital Link International Shipping Forum on Monday, March 31,
2025, at the Metropolitan Club in New York City. The event is
organized in cooperation with NASDAQ & NYSE.
The Forum features a series of panel discussions
as well as 1x1 meetings between investors and executives from
shipping companies.

FORUM OVERVIEW AND STRUCTURE
Held in New York City every year, the Annual
International Shipping Forum is known for its large attendance by
investors, shipowners and financiers. It is a meeting place for
C-level Executives from the maritime industry and the finance and
investment communities involved with shipping.
The Forum will examine the macroeconomic issues
that are shaping and transforming the international shipping
markets today, featuring a comprehensive review and outlook of the
various shipping markets, made more relevant by the release of
companies’ annual results.
The conference will feature senior executives from
leading maritime companies, financiers and industry participants
who will discuss trends, development and the outlook of the various
shipping market segments and will also cover topics of critical
interest to the shipping industry, such as geopolitics, the new
energy landscape, sanctions, access to capital, regulation,
technology, innovation and more.
The Forum features a series of panel discussions as
well as 1x1 meetings between investors and executives from shipping
companies.
This one-day conference is known for its rich
informational content and the extensive marketing, networking and
business development opportunities.

ORGANIZER –
CAPITAL LINK, INC.
Founded in 1995, Capital Link is a New York based
investor relations, financial communications and advisory firm with
a strategic focus on the maritime, commodities and energy sectors,
MLPs, as well as Closed-End Funds and ETFs. In addition, Capital
Link organizes a series of investment conferences a year in key
industry centers in the United States, Europe and Asia, all of
which are known for combining rich educational and informational
content with unique marketing and networking opportunities. Capital
Link is a member of the Baltic Exchange. Based in New York City,
Capital Link has presence in London, Athens & Oslo.
